Context: The Privacy L2's Identity Crisis Aztec Network sits at the intersection of zero-knowledge proofs and Ethereum privacy. Its V4 has been a cornerstone for users wanting private DeFi interactions — from shielded swaps to confidential voting. But like any early-stage protocol, it carries technical debt. The proving system — the cryptographic backbone that validates transactions without exposing data — harbors a flaw. Not a theoretical one. A real, exploitable hole that could allow an attacker to forge valid proofs for invalid transactions.

Normally, teams patch such holes quietly. Deploy a fix, maybe a stealth upgrade. But Aztec chose a different path: they're using a governance vote to formally approve the V5 upgrade — and the vote will publicly document the V4 vulnerability. This is not a mistake. It's a deliberate design decision. And it creates a terrifying window.

Core: The Governance Gap Here’s what’s happening: Between now and June 25, V4 users must bridge out their assets. Once the governance vote passes, the vulnerability will be public. Anyone — from white-hat bounty hunters to black-hat MEV extractors — can read the code, understand the exploit, and drain any remaining funds still stuck in V4. The team is essentially forcing a mass exodus before they reveal the blueprint for the bank vault.

Here’s the kicker: V5 itself doesn’t have a vulnerability, but the migration mechanism introduces a systemic one. The trust model shifts from "the bug is hidden" to "the bug is known, and we rely on everyone to run before the predator can."

Let’s break the technical implications. The proving-system flaw means a malicious actor could produce a zero-knowledge proof that the network would accept as valid, even if the underlying transaction is fraudulent. That’s not a small bug; that’s a protocol-level backdoor. V5 rebuilds the proving system from scratch — likely switching to a more robust circuit design. But the cost is that V4’s failure becomes a public textbook case.

Data from on-chain analytics (like Dune) will show a clear sprint: TVL in Aztec V4 will hemorrhage as the deadline approaches. Expect a 70–90% drop in total value locked by June 24. The remaining 10%? That’s the risk pool. Some users will be asleep, some will be locked in complex DeFi positions that can’t unwind quickly, and some will gamble that the window is survivable.

Contrarian: Why This Might Be the Right Move (and Why It’s Still Dangerous) Conventional wisdom says: patch first, disclose later. Aztec reversed that. And here’s the contrarian take: they might be right. By putting the vulnerability disclosure to a governance vote, they’re forcing the community to own the decision. No backroom fixes. No centralized fiat. It’s a radical transparency experiment. If it works — if every rational actor withdraws on time and the V5 launch is clean — it sets a precedent for how protocols handle catastrophic bugs without sacrificing decentralization.

But most governance models were not designed for emergencies. They’re slow, deliberative, and prone to capture. Exposing a live exploit to a vote is like sending a signal flare while standing in a powder keg. The blind spot here isn’t the code; it’s the assumption that the market’s reaction function is faster than an attacker’s exploit script. In reality, MEV bots are already scanning for any new vulnerability disclosures. The moment that governance post goes live, the race begins.
